Abstract
A Ni/Cd or Ni/hydride storage battery of the button cell type has a positive electrode tablet based on a nickel hydroxide powder having an active mass comprised of spherical particles with a high pycnometric density (d>3.5 g/cm.sup.3). In contrast to conventional nickel hydroxide powders having irregular particles, a better space utilization is achieved during dry pressing due to a narrow particle-size distribution having a maximum in a range of from 5 to 20 .mu.m, and due to the rounded particle surfaces. The specific volumetric capacity of the resulting button cell electrode is consequently approximately 25% higher than that of a conventional positive button cell electrode. A microporous separator having pore sizes smaller than the mean diameter of the spherical particles prevents the danger of short circuits.
